For children entering grades 1–3.

Our planet is an exciting place! Explore geology and paleontology using the museum’s collections and exhibits. Study rocks, fossils, volcanoes, and earthquakes through experiments, specimens, stories, and models.

About Summer Science Week

Each Summer Science Week program is taught by a professional educator and serves a maximum of 15 students. Based in one of the museum classrooms, students work independently and in groups to examine museum specimens, conduct experiments, create crafts, explore museum galleries, play games, and have fun!
